Summary: The email summarizes a conference before Judge Berman regarding Jeffrey Epstein's death, where defense counsel and victims' attorneys requested court oversight of the investigation, and victims shared detailed accounts of their experiences with Epstein. Judge Berman did not dismiss the case and is expected to decide on the requests in a written opinion.
